JPMorganChase · 14 hours ago
Lead Software Engineer - Java/AWS/Oracle
JPMorganChase is one of the oldest financial institutions, offering innovative financial solutions to a wide array of clients. As a Lead Software Engineer, you will be responsible for enhancing and delivering technology products while conducting critical technology solutions across various business functions.
FinanceBankingAsset ManagementFinancial Services
Responsibilities
Executes software solutions, design, development, and technical troubleshooting with ability to think beyond routine or conventional approaches to build solutions or break down technical problems
Creates secure and high-quality production code and maintains algorithms that run synchronously with appropriate systems
Produces architecture and design artifacts for complex applications while being accountable for ensuring design constraints are met by software code development
Identifies opportunities to eliminate or automate remediation of recurring issues to improve overall operational stability of software applications and systems
Manage priorities and set expectations when faced with multiple demanding tasks. Clearly articulates and communicates project status to stakeholders and management
Leads communities of practice across Software Engineering to drive awareness and use of new and leading-edge technologies
Qualification
Required
Formal training or certification on software engineering concepts and 5+ years applied experience
Hands-on practical experience in system design, application development, testing, and operational stability
Expert-level proficiency in developing, debugging, and maintaining applications using Java, Spring, Spring Boot, Microservices, MQ, Apache Kafka, REST Api, gRPC, Oracle, PostgresSQL, SQL
Proficiency in observability tools such as Splunk, Datadog, Grafana
Demonstrated experience in cloud technologies such as AWS, Kubernetes, EKS, ECS, Lambda, Docker, and Helm
Experience in Test Driven Development with unit testing, acceptance testing using JUnit, Cucumber, Fitnesse
Strong grasp of application resiliency, scalability and security principles
Comprehensive understanding of the Software Development Life Cycle and CI/CD pipelines
Demonstrated experience working in an Agile environment on a Scrum team
Initiative and creativity in refining testing processes and improving quality
Preferred
Experience working with AI automation frameworks and integrating Large Language Models (LLMs) into software solutions, including prompt engineering, model evaluation, and deployment
Familiarity with LLM platforms and tools (such as OpenAI, Hugging Face, or similar)
Strong ability to manage own workload and deliver to required deadlines
Benefits
Comprehensive health care coverage
On-site health and wellness centers
A retirement savings plan
Backup childcare
Tuition reimbursement
Mental health support
Financial coaching
Company
JPMorganChase
With a history tracing its roots to 1799 in New York City, JPMorganChase is one of the world's oldest, largest, and best-known financial institutions—carrying forth the innovative spirit of our heritage firms in global operations across 100 markets.
H1B Sponsorship
JPMorganChase has a track record of offering H1B sponsorships. Please note that this does not
guarantee sponsorship for this specific role. Below presents additional info for your
reference. (Data Powered by US Department of Labor)
Distribution of Different Job Fields Receiving Sponsorship
Represents job field similar to this job
Trends of Total Sponsorships
2025 (3471)
2024 (3469)
2023 (3395)
2022 (3594)
2021 (2515)
2020 (2495)
Funding
Current Stage
Public CompanyTotal Funding
unknown1998-02-01IPO
Leadership Team
Recent News
2026-02-12
2026-02-12
Payments Dive
2026-02-12
Company data provided by crunchbase